[发明专利]一种移动互联网视频直播平台在审
申请号: | 201710049031.X | 申请日: | 2017-01-23 |
公开(公告)号: | CN106973300A | 公开(公告)日: | 2017-07-21 |
发明(设计)人: | 陆朝晖 | 申请(专利权)人: | 北京颐和正新科技有限公司 |
主分类号: | H04N21/2187 | 分类号: | H04N21/2187;H04N21/472;H04N21/488;H04N21/643;H04N21/6587;H04N21/8355 |
代理公司: | 北京奥翔领智专利代理有限公司11518 | 代理人: | 路远 |
地址: | 101500 北京*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 移动 互联网 视频 直播 平台 | ||
技术领域
本发明涉及一种移动互联网视频直播平台。
背景技术
随着计算机技术发展的日新月异,网络技术日益成熟以及宽带网的发展,流媒体技术越来越广泛地应用于视频点播系统、互联网直播、远程教育、网络在线培训、视频会议等应用领域。近年来,4G移动通信网作为日趋完善的无线网络,为流媒体的应用提供了一个崭新的平台,也为流媒体技术更好的为使用者服务开辟了新的传输媒体,移动流媒体及视频交互应用得到了快速发展。随着手机增值业务的不断发展,视音频流媒体业务将会成为4G增值业务的热点,通过手机实现视频点播、收看视频节目成为最能吸引用户眼球的业务之一。
在许多场景中,用户可能无法或无法完整收看及收听直播流媒体,或者希望能够在未来时间收看及收听过去的直播流媒体。对此,现有技术中提供了将直播流媒体下载到用户终端的方法。然而,一般情况下直播流媒体的数据量较大,尤其是视频流媒体,而用户终端的存储空间有限,难以满足直播流媒体的下载需求。另一方面,用户终端也可能不能保持下载直播流媒体所需的持续网络连接,导致无法下载直播流媒体。
发明内容
鉴于现有技术中存在的上述问题,本发明的主要目的在于提供一种移动互联网视频直播平台,该平台采用XMPP协议及其扩展协议、RTP、RTCP、RSTP等实现手机移动流媒体播放和视频的双向交互。
本发明提供了一种移动互联网视频直播平台,包括直播服务器和客户端,所述客户端通过移动互联网与所述直播服务器相连接,其中:
所述直播服务器包括信令管理模块、认证及在线状态模块、即时通信模块和流媒体管理模块;所述信令管理模块,用来处理指令信息以及将不同格式的指令转换成统一的XMPP格式的信令;所述认证及在线状态模块提供用户的接口认证、资源分配及状态呈现;所述即时通信模块用于发送和接收文本、语音和视频交互数据;所述流媒体管理模块提供节目点播和节目源的直播功能,并对节目和节目进行统一管理;
所述客户端包括依次连接的连接处理模块、XMPP编解码模块、消息处理模块、移动流媒体播放模块和图形用户接口模块;所述连接处理模块用来创建连接;所述XMPP编解码模块用于解析所述连接处理模块收到的XMPP格式的信令数据流,并发送给所述消息处理模块;所述消息处理模块用于对解析后的信令数据进行处理,并反馈给所述图形用户接口模块;所述移动流媒体播放模块用于控制节目播放和直播视频;所述图形用户接口模块用于与用户进行交互;
还包括存储服务器,所述存储服务器分别与所述客户端和所述直播服务器通信连接,用于对所述直播服务器播放后的节目和直播后的视频进行存储。
进一步的,所述指令信息包括用户登录信息、用户状态信息、流媒体指令、文本信息、语音指令和视频指令。
进一步的,所述消息处理模块包括文本信息处理组件、交互视频流信息处理组件、语音信息处理组件和流媒体信息处理组件。
进一步的,所述消息处理模块还包括联系人列表组件和注册组件。
进一步的,所述即时通信模块包括文本控制及发送器、语音控制及发送器、视频控制及发送器;其中,文本控制及发送器用于向客户端发送及接收来自客户端的即时文本信息;语音控制及发送器负责接收和向客户端发送语音信令,用于控制语音包传送过程和录音过程;视频控制及发送器负责视频数据的发送和接收,提供视频缓冲功能。
进一步的,所述存储服务器为网盘或云盘。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京颐和正新科技有限公司,未经北京颐和正新科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710049031.X/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种直播状态显示系统及方法
- 下一篇:一种视频直播管理方法及装置